Standing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small puddle on the floor Yes No It’s manageable but can hide deeper issues
Water under the carpet No Yes It’s hidden and can cause mold
Water in the walls No Yes It’s dangerous and needs special tools
Water from a broken pipe No Yes It’s urgent and can spread fast
Water from a flood No Yes It’s a large amount and needs quick action
Water in the basement No Yes It’s hard to access and can be unsafe

Standing Water Extraction Cost In Glen Rose, TX

Costs vary depending on the size of the problem. You need to know what to expect. Prices start at $500 and go up based on the amount of water. You don’t want to wait. You need to act. You need to protect your home. You need to feel safe.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, location, and time of day
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of area, moisture levels, and drying time
Mold Inspection $100 – $500 Extent of mold and areas affected
Water Extraction Equipment $200 – $1,000 Type of equipment and job complexity
Final Inspection $50 – $200 Time and detail of the inspection
More Services $100 – $500 Extra cleaning, repairs, or restoration
